The issues related to open gutters are well-known among homeowners: leaves, twigs, and dirt tend to accumulate quickly, leading to blockages that cause water to overflow and potentially damage the home's foundation, siding, or landscaping. Open gutters require regular cleaning to prevent these problems, which can be time-consuming and sometimes hazardous. Residential gutter covers are often viewed as a way to address these challenges by preventing debris from entering the system in the first place. Homeowners exploring this topic are usually interested in understanding how gutter covers can reduce maintenance, improve water flow, and protect the property, especially in areas with lots of trees or seasonal debris.
This topic often involves various types of properties, including single-family homes, multi-unit residences, and even some small commercial buildings. The size, roof design, and surrounding landscape influence the choice between open gutters and gutter covers. For example, homes with large, complex rooflines or extensive tree coverage are more likely to benefit from gutter covers to manage debris and prevent clogs. Conversely, properties in areas with minimal foliage may find open gutters sufficient, though some still consider covers for convenience. How do residential gutter covers compare to open gutters in preventing debris buildup? Gutter covers are designed to block leaves and debris from entering the gutter system, reducing the frequency of cleaning, while open gutters require regular maintenance to remove accumulated debris. What maintenance is needed for residential gutter covers compared to open gutters? Gutter covers typically require less frequent cleaning since they block debris, whereas open gutters need regular removal of leaves and dirt. Can gutter covers be installed on existing gutters, or are they only for new installations? Gutter covers can often be added to existing gutters through retrofit installation, as well as installed during new gutter systems.
